Abstract: | This paper presents the case for the use of dual-polarimetric entropy/alpha parameters in classification of healthy vs. unhealthy vegetation (River Red Gum - Eucalyptus camaldulensis). TerraSAR-X fully polarimetric data from the Dual Receive Antenna (DRA) mode campaign performed early in 2010 is used for this purpose. |
